First, spritz the pressure-treated wood with water. Check to see if the wood is absorbing the water or not. If the wood soaks up the water in less than ten minutes, this indicates that you should stain the wood as soon as feasible. The wood isn’t dry enough to stain if water beads up or accumulates on the deck surface.

For decks and patios that measure up to 175 square feet, you will only need one gallon of stain, in any transparency. If your deck or patio measures up to 550 square feet, you will need to buy 2 gallons of stain.
